Desenvolvedor Full-Stack

Joinville, Santa Catarina, Brasil Full-time

Conheça um pouco mais sobre o que nosso time de engenharia está fazendo: https://medium.com/mercos-engineering

Essa vaga é para trabalhar nos times responsáveis pela nossa aplicação web.

Como é o nosso BackEnd:

  • Python / Django;
  • MySQL / Redis;
  • Regras de negócio isoladas do framework;
  • Clean Architecture: Usecases, Entities, Gateways;
  • Não seguimos a Clean Architecture como dogma, adaptamos à nossa realidade;
  • Testes automatizados e TDD onde for possível;
  • Legado com regras em models e views que estamos migrando aos poucos;

Como é o nosso FrontEnd:

  • Javascript / React;
  • Flexbox e SASS;
  • Redux apenas nas telas mais complexas;
  • Testes de UI e de regressão visual;
  • Legado com restos de Bootstrap e jQuery que estamos migrando aos poucos;

O que esperamos de você:

  • Conhecimentos gerais:
    • Python / Django;
    • Javascript / React;
    • Clean Code / Clean Architecture / Testes Automatizados;
  • Profundidade de conhecimento e experiência em algum dos itens acima;
  • Disposição à aprender rapidamente os itens acima que não tiver conhecimento;
  • Disponibilidade para se mudar para Joinville/SC;

Como é o nosso ambiente de trabalho:

  • Great Place To Work®: 8º lugar entre as melhores pequenas empresas para se trabalhar em Santa Catarina;
  • Love Mondays®: 21º lugar entre as pequenas empresas mais amadas pelos funcionários do Brasil;
  • Ambiente ágil, informal e sem dresscode;
  • Muito compartilhamento de conhecimento: toda semana temos internamente palestras e meetups, além de livros e incentivos para ir em eventos e escrever artigos;

Como é o time:

  • Um time de profissionais de produto, designers e desenvolvedores onde todos são encorajados a perguntar o motivo do que estão fazendo e sugerir alternativas melhores;
  • Muitos desafios onde a qualidade do produto e do código é muito cobrada;
  • Não fazemos customizações, os recursos são usados todos os dias por milhares de usuários;
  • 20% do tempo liberado para dedicar a projetos individuais: refatorações, melhorias técnicas, testar novas tecnologias ou até mesmo colaborar com projetos open-source;

Como é a infraestrutura:

  • Posto de trabalho com Mac, monitor de 24” e internet sem restrições de acesso;
  • Licença do PyCharm e liberdade para usar a IDE de sua preferência;
  • Ferramentaria de CI/CD com mais de 8000 testes rodando em menos de 7 minutos, para podermos liberar alterações rapidamente;
  • Cobertura de mais de 75% de código (e aumentando), para podermos dormir tranquilos de noite;

Benefícios:

  • Contratação CLT;
  • Vale transporte ou combustível;
  • Vale refeição ou alimentação;
  • Plano de saúde e odontológico;
  • Programa de stock options;

Apply for this opening at http://mercos.recruiterbox.com/jobs/fk0zz9?apply=true